5 Underrated Tools for Writers Professionals to Master

As writers, we're always seeking tools that can help us streamline our workflow, boost productivity, and elevate our writing to new heights. While some of the most effective tools are well-known, others often fly under the radar. In this post, we'll explore five underrated tools that every writer professional should master.

1. Grammarly

Grammarly is a powerful tool that's often overlooked by writers. This AI-powered platform not only checks grammar and spelling but also offers suggestions for improving writing style, tone, and clarity. With Grammarly, you can ensure your writing is polished and error-free, without sacrificing your unique voice or tone.

2. Trello

Trello is a visual project management tool that's perfect for writers who need to stay organized. This platform allows you to create boards, lists, and cards to track projects and deadlines. With Trello, you can collaborate with other writers or editors, set reminders, prioritize tasks – all in one place.

3. The Hemingway Editor

The Hemingway Editor is a simple yet effective tool for improving the readability of your writing. This platform analyzes your text and provides suggestions for simplifying complex sentences, reducing wordiness, and making your writing more accessible to readers. With The Hemingway Editor, you can ensure your writing is clear and concise, without sacrificing its impact.

4. Pocket

Pocket is a popular tool for writers who need to save articles, blog posts, or other web content for later reading. This platform allows you to capture web pages, articles, and videos with the click of a button, and access them offline whenever you want. With Pocket, you can research and prepare for your writing projects without being tied to your computer.

5. RescueTime

RescueTime is a time-tracking tool that's essential for writers who need to stay focused. This platform tracks how you spend your time on your computer or mobile device, providing insights into productivity and habits. With RescueTime, you can identify areas where you might be wasting time, set goals and alerts, and optimize your workflow for maximum efficiency.
